17331311 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 17331312. Its totient is φ = 17331310.
The previous prime is 17331289. The next prime is 17331319. The reversal of 17331311 is 11313371.
It is a strong prime.
It is an emirp because it is prime and its reverse (11313371) is a distict prime.
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 17331311 - 26 = 17331247 is a prime.
It is a congruent number.
It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(17331319)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 8665655 + 8665656.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(8665656).
Almost surely, 217331311 is an apocalyptic number.
17331311 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).
17331311 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
17331311 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The product of its digits is 189, while the sum is 20.
The square root of 17331311 is about 4163.0891174703. The cubic root of 17331311 is about 258.7878039158.
Adding to 17331311 its reverse (11313371), we get a palindrome (28644682).
The spelling of 17331311 in words is "seventeen million, three hundred thirty-one thousand, three hundred eleven".
